CVE-2023-35386
HIGHCVSS 7.8/10EPSS 5.55%
Last modified
CVE-2023-35386 is a high-severity vulnerability rated 7.8/10 on the CVSS scale. Windows Kernel Elevation of Privilege Vulnerability. EPSS estimates a 5.55% chance of exploitation in the next 30 days.

Affected Software
| Vendor | Product | Versions |
|---|---|---|
| Microsoft | Windows 10 1507 | < 10.0.10240.20107 |
| Microsoft | Windows 10 1607 | < 10.0.14393.6167 |
| Microsoft | Windows 10 1809 | < 10.0.17763.4737 |
| Microsoft | Windows 10 21h2 | < 10.0.19044.3324 |
| Microsoft | Windows 10 22h2 | < 10.0.19045.3324 |
| Microsoft | Windows 11 21h2 | < 10.0.22000.2295 |
| Microsoft | Windows 11 22h2 | < 10.0.22621.2134 |
| Microsoft | Windows Server 2012 | r2 |
| Microsoft | Windows Server 2016 | All versions |
| Microsoft | Windows Server 2019 | All versions |
| Microsoft | Windows Server 2022 | All versions |
